• HOME
  • NEWS
  • VIDEOS
  • DOCUMENTARIES
  • PODCASTS
  • LEADERBOARDS
  • MORE
    CHANNELS READER
    ABOUT
  • DOWNLOAD APP
Owen to leave role as Mercedes chief designer

Mercedes chief designer John Owen, a key figure in multiple drivers' and constructors' championship wins, is to leave the team later this year.

January 20, 2026 from BBC - Formula 1
Read Full Article
More from BBC - Formula 1
Verstappen 'not intending to use' cooling vest but Russell will 'run it'
BBC - Formula 1
Verstappen 'not intending to use' cooling vest but Russell will 'run it'
Swearing punishment could speed up F1 exit - Verstappen
Andrew Benson / BBC - Formula 1
Swearing punishment could speed up F1 exit - Verstappen
In pictures - F1's 2024 cars so far
BBC - Formula 1
In pictures - F1's 2024 cars so far
  • Latest News
  • Videos
  • Channels
  • Documentaries
  • Leaderboard
  • Voice Reader
  • About
  • Contact
  • Social Media

© 2026 F1IAN. All rights reserved